G4072 - Fly
| Strong's No.: | G4072 | 
| Greek: | πέτομαι | 
| Transliteration: | petomai petaomai ptaomai | 
| Phonetic: | pet'-om-ahee pet-ah'-om-ahee ptah'-om-ahee | 
| Word Origin: | Including the prolonged form (second form) and contraction (third form) of the middle voice of a primary verb | 
| Bible Usage: | fly (-ing). | 
| Part of Speech: | Verb | 
| Strongs Definition:  | to fly  | 
| Thayers Definition:  | 1. to fly  |
